What is the Internet Banking Bill Payment Enrollment Form?
The Internet Banking Bill Payment Enrollment Form is designed for customers of Colonial Co-operative Bank to enroll in the Bill Pay service. This form is crucial for accessing and utilizing the benefits of this convenient banking feature. Notably, the form has undergone revisions, with the most recent update in July 2014, ensuring that all necessary information is accurately captured for effective use.

Key Features of the Internet Banking Bill Payment Enrollment Form
This enrollment form requires specific information from users to facilitate processing. Users must provide:
-
Name
-
Social Security Number (SSN)
-
Address
-
Account Number
The form also outlines terms and conditions related to the Bill Pay service, detailing customer responsibilities including safeguarding their login credentials.

Who is eligible to use the Internet Banking Bill Payment Enrollment Form?
Any customer of Colonial Co-operative Bank who wishes to enroll in their Bill Pay service is eligible to complete this form.
What should I do if I miss the enrollment deadline?
If you miss the enrollment deadline, you may need to contact Colonial Co-operative Bank directly to ask for guidance on late enrollment or if there are alternative options available.
How do I submit the completed form?
You can submit the completed form by bringing it to a branch location of Colonial Co-operative Bank or upload it as instructed if they allow online submissions.
What documents are required to complete this form?
To complete this form, you will need personal identification details such as your name, Social Security Number (SSN), address, and bank account number.
What are some common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Common mistakes include omitting required fields, miswriting your account information, or forgetting to sign and date the form. Double-check all entries before submitting.
How long does it take to process the enrollment?
Processing times can vary, but it typically takes a few business days. Check with Colonial Co-operative Bank for specific timelines.
Is notarization required for this form?
No, notarization is not required when submitting the Internet Banking Bill Payment Enrollment Form for Colonial Co-operative Bank.
